The Postal Service has announced that it filed a request with the Postal Regulatory Commission. This request involves adding a new shipping services contract to a list of special agreements in their Competitive Products List. The filing took place on December 6, 2024, and includes the addition of contracts for services like Priority Mail Express, Priority Mail, and USPS Ground AdvantageĀ®. More information about the request can be found on the Commissionās website.
